Understanding uPVC Doors and Windows: Benefits, Features, and Applications<br>uPVC (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ride) windows and doors have become a popular option in contemporary architecture due to their durability, energy effectiveness, and aesthetic appeal. This post dives into the various elements of uPVC doors and windows, highlighting their benefits, features, and common applications, while likewise addressing frequently asked questions.<br>What is uPVC?<br>uPVC is a kind of polyvinyl chloride (PVC) that lacks the plasticizers that make it versatile. This rigidness gives uPVC its strength and sturdiness, making it a favored material for constructing windows and doors. Using uPVC in building materials has actually surged in popularity due to its low upkeep requirements and long lifespan.<br>Benefits of uPVC Doors and Windows<br>Sturdiness and Longevity<br>uPVC windows and doors are resistant to rot, rust, and weathering, which permits them to withstand harsh environmental conditions. Unlike wood, uPVC does not warp or swell when exposed to moisture, guaranteeing a long life expectancy.<br>Energy Efficiency<br>Among the standout functions of uPVC is its outstanding insulation properties. By lessening heat transfer, uPVC windows and doors can substantially minimize energy expenses by keeping homes cool in summer season and warm in winter season.<br>Low Maintenance<br>uPVC products require minimal maintenance compared to traditional materials such as wood or aluminum. They can be quickly cleaned up with soap and water, and there is no requirement for painting or varnishing, which further reduces long-lasting costs.<br>Security Features<br>uPVC doors are typically geared up with multi-point locking systems that enhance security. The robust nature of uPVC makes it hard to force open, offering assurance for house owners.<br>Aesthetic Versatility<br>Available in a variety of colors, surfaces, and styles, uPVC can be personalized to suit any architectural style.
